3D Printing in Oral Surgery
To improve the field of dental surgery, you can discover the subtopic of 3D printing in dental surgery. look at these guys has the prospective to transform the means dental doctors operate and deal with people. Here are four key ways in which 3D printing is shaping the area:
- ** Personalized Surgical Guides **: 3D printing enables the development of very precise and patient-specific surgical guides, boosting the accuracy and efficiency of treatments.
- ** Implant Prosthetics **: With 3D printing, dental surgeons can develop customized implant prosthetics that perfectly fit a client's one-of-a-kind makeup, causing much better results and patient contentment.
- ** Bone Grafting **: 3D printing makes it possible for the production of patient-specific bone grafts, lowering the need for conventional implanting methods and improving recovery and recovery time.
- ** Education and Training **: 3D printing can be utilized to produce reasonable surgical versions for academic functions, enabling oral doctors to practice complicated procedures before performing them on people.
With its prospective to enhance precision, personalization, and training, 3D printing is an interesting growth in the field of oral surgery.
Minimally Invasive Strategies
To additionally advance the field of oral surgery, embrace the potential of minimally invasive methods that can substantially benefit both doctors and patients alike.
Minimally intrusive techniques are transforming the field by decreasing medical trauma, lessening post-operative discomfort, and increasing the healing procedure. These strategies involve making use of smaller sized lacerations and specialized tools to execute treatments with accuracy and performance.
By utilizing advanced imaging modern technology, such as cone light beam computed tomography (CBCT), doctors can precisely prepare and execute surgeries with minimal invasiveness.
